Application Information

Applications accepted Grace lutheran church and school believes in the value of all children as god's creation. we strive to discover and seek what is best for each child. certain criteria has been established by the board for day school ministries for grace lutheran school to ensure a quality christian education program for each and every student. students making application should meet at least the minimal requirements for admission in the the areas of: (a) academics - average to above average level of achievement, (b) behavior - good discipline record, (c) character - positive recommendations. a child entering preschool or kindergarten must be three (3), four (4), or five (5) years of age one or before september 1 of the year enrolling. upon acceptance to grace lutheran school: · we will have received the application fee, along with the signed contract. · submit a copy of your child’s birth certificate, baptismal certificate if applicable, social security number, health and immunization record. these documents are required for all students entering grace lutheran school. · an interview with the early childhood director or principal is required.
Deadline for applicationsJanuary 31
Application Information $150.00
Acceptance criteria: Grace Lutheran School is a ministry of Grace Lutheran Church and as such is open to families of the congregation and families of the community desiring a Christian education for their children. Grace Lutheran School admits students of any race, color, national and ethnic origin to all the rights, privileges, programs, and activities generally accorded or made available to students at the school. It does not discriminate on the basis of race, color, national and ethnic origin in administration of its education policies, admission policies, scholarsip and loan programs, or athletic and other school programs. Congregational members and students enrolled in the prior year will be given priority registration status through the month of January. Beginning February 1, enrollment opens to the public on a first come, first served basis

Trace around your child's foot, with shoe on, on a piece of white construction paper or card stock. Have child cut out the shoe print and add a spooky face. Glue it to a popsicle stick and you have a ghost stick puppet!
